Brazil won in straight sets against Italy with Ricardo Lucarelli again leading the scoring for the Brazilian boys with 12 points to move further ahead in Group A, whilst Italy's faint hopes of taking second place in the league are dashed. On the Italian side the wing spiker Ivan Zaytsev scored 9 and was the top scorer for the European side. Brazil’s coach Bernardo Rezende said: "Our service worked really well today. A good service is the key to a good match. We have to keep up the pressure with the service and do not mind the errors, because when you force your services the risk is bigger. Another goal for us is to save the ball and keep it flying to try the counter-attack. The Italians have a tough block, so we needed to overcome it using our skills, not the physical strength".
